Skip to content

feat: IMAP folder quoting, add feed entry limits, responsive feed content, update CI workflow#27

Open
narcistesa wants to merge 6 commits intoLeonMusCoden:masterfrom
narcistesa:feat/feed-cleanup-and-formatting
Open

feat: IMAP folder quoting, add feed entry limits, responsive feed content, update CI workflow#27
narcistesa wants to merge 6 commits intoLeonMusCoden:masterfrom
narcistesa:feat/feed-cleanup-and-formatting

Conversation

@narcistesa
Copy link
Copy Markdown

@narcistesa narcistesa commented Apr 3, 2026

  • Quote folder names in IMAP COPY to handle spaces
  • Add max_entries_per_feed setting
  • Use inline styles for responsive feed content
  • Use dynamic repository owner in CI image names

narcistesa and others added 2 commits April 3, 2026 16:21
- Quote folder names in IMAP COPY to handle spaces
- Add max_entries_per_feed setting (DB + UI) and max_entries_master_feed (env-only)
- Wrap feed entry HTML in responsive container to constrain wide content

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
@narcistesa narcistesa changed the title feat: IMAP folder quoting, add feed entry limits, responsive feed content feat: IMAP folder quoting, add feed entry limits, responsive feed content, update CI workflow Apr 3, 2026
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
@narcistesa narcistesa marked this pull request as draft April 3, 2026 21:32
narcistesa and others added 3 commits April 3, 2026 19:02
- Replace <style> tag approach with inline styles via BeautifulSoup
- Strip hardcoded width/height from img, table, td, div elements

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
@narcistesa narcistesa marked this pull request as ready for review April 4, 2026 00:27
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ant